Файл: Отчет о выполнении лабораторной работы 0 арифметические основы цвм по дисциплине дискретные структуры.docx

ВУЗ: Не указан

Категория: Отчет по практике

Дисциплина: Не указана

Добавлен: 05.12.2023

Просмотров: 10

Скачиваний: 1

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.

МИНИСТЕРСТВО НАУКИ И ВЫСШЕГО ОБРАЗОВАНИЯ РОССИЙСКОЙ ФЕДЕРАЦИИ

ФГАОУ ВО«СЕВАСТОПОЛЬСКИЙ ГОСУДАРСТВЕННЫЙ УНИВЕРСИТЕТ»

Кафедра информационных технологий и компьютерных систем


ОТЧЕТ

о выполнении лабораторной работы №0
«АРИФМЕТИЧЕСКИЕ ОСНОВЫ ЦВМ»

по дисциплине
«ДИСКРЕТНЫЕ СТРУКТУРЫ»

Вариант № 26

Выполнил:

ст.гр.ИТ/б-22-4-о

Сорокин Я.А.
Проверил:

доцент кафедры ИТиКС

Ченгарь О.В.,

ассистент кафедры ИТиКС

Малицкая А.А.,

старший преподаватель кафедры ИТиКС

Владимирова Е.С.

Севастополь,
2022

Задание 1. Задано смешанное число в десятичной системе счисления (см. таблицу). Выполнить его перевод из одной системы счисления в другую в соответствии с указанной схемой.

Задание 2. Заданы целые числа по абсолютной величине |А| и |В|. (Числа выбрать из таблицы, рассматривая целую часть как |А|, а дробную- как |В|. Представить числа в двоичной системе счисления. Выполнить сложение знаковых чисел, используя указанный код:

а) +А+В, обратный код,

б) -А+В, обратный код,

в) А+ (-В), дополнительный код,

г) -А+(-В) дополнительный код.

Результаты представить в прямом коде.

ИНДИВИДУАЛЬНОЕ ЗАДАНИЕ ПО ВАРИАНТУ

Число: 138,59

Схема перевода: 10162810

ХОД РАБОТЫ

Задание 1:

  1. 138,5910 – Х16

Перевод целого числа:

138/16=1016

Перевод десятичного числа:

0,59*16=9,4416

0,44*16=7,0416

Итог:10,97

  1. 10,9716 – Х2

Перевод целого числа:

1016 = 10102

Перевод десятичного числа:

916 = 10012

716 = 01112

Итог:1010,100101112

  1. 1010,100101112 - Х8

Перевод целого числа:

0010102 - 128

Перевод десятичного числа:

0100101112 - 2278

Итог:12,2278

  1. 12,2278 – Х10

Перевод целого числа:

128 =(1*8
1)+(2*80)=8+2=1010

Перевод десятичного числа:

2278 =(2*8(-1))+(2*8(-2))+(7*8(3))=0,25+0,03125+0,013671875=

=0,25+0,03+0,01=0,2910

Итог:10,2910.

Задание 2:

А=13810.В=5910.

Перевод целого числа:

А=13810 =0 100010102.

B = 5910= 0 01110112
Итог: А = 0 100010102 В= 0 001110112
-А=1 011101012 -В= 1 110001002
а)+А+В = 10001010

+ =110001012.

00111011
Итог:110001012.
б) -А+В = 0 00111011

+ = 1 101100002.

1 01110101
Итог:1 101100002.
в)А+ (-В) = 1 11000100

+ = 1 110001012

1
0 11000101

+ = 0 010011112.

1 10001010
Итог:0 010011112.

г) -А+(-В)= 1 01110101 1 11000100

+ =1 011101102 + =1 110001012

1 1

1 01110110

+ =1 001110112

1 11000101
Итог:110001002.


ВЫВОДЫ ПО РАБОТЕ

В ходе работы былрассмотрен перевод чисел в различные системы счисления. Также выполнены вычисления арифметических операций в прямом, обратном и дополнительном кодахположительных и отрицательных двоичных чисел.